This simulator pulls a virtual test bar and traces its stress-strain curve live, alongside a schematic specimen that stretches, necks and fractures in sync with the plot. Choose a material to set its Young's modulus and base strength, then tune grain size to watch the Hall-Petch relation shift the yield point — smaller grains mean a higher yield stress because grain boundaries block dislocation glide. Ductile metals show a clear elastic-to-plastic transition and neck before breaking; the brittle ceramic preset snaps with almost no warning, illustrating why crack-sensitive materials are designed with large safety margins.
